exhibitorBioOne

BioOne is a nonprofit aggregation of primary research in the biological, ecological, and environmental sciences. Founded in 1999, BioOne provides a sustainable online platform for journals and books published by nonprofit societies, associations, museums, institutions, and presses.

exhibitorSpringer

Springer is one of the leading international scientific publishing companies. Founded in 1842, it is today the largest science, technology, and medicine (STM) book publisher in the world. Through partnerships with more than 300 academic associations and professional societies worldwide, the company publishes more than 2,000 journals and 7,000 new book titles each year, in addition to offering an array of online services including SpringerLink and SpringerMaterials.
